>Listmembers:
>Do not panic about the recent virus warnings to the Pace Mail List.
>Rootsweb, the host of the mail lists, long ago established the policy of
not
>allowing attachments to be posted to mail lists. My understanding is that
>viruses are virtually always transmitted as an attachment to an email, so
the
>Rootsweb policy prevents these viruses being transmitted to any
listmembers.
>The key thing to remember to prevent downloading a virus is: Do not open
any
>attachment to an email unless the subject of the email explains what the
>attachment is! Also, it is unwise to open an attachment from an unknown
>source.
>Gordon W. Pace
